Excerpt from the Sterling Corp. Employee Handbook: Section 4: Use of Company Resources and Conduct

Welcome to Sterling Corp! We are delighted to have you on our team. This handbook serves as a guide to our company policies and expectations. Please familiarize yourself with its contents.

4.1 Company Property: All equipment, software, and materials provided by Sterling Corp are company property. They are intended for business use only. Unauthorized personal use, modification, or removal is strictly prohibited. Employees found in violation may face disciplinary action, up to and including termination. This includes company-provided laptops, mobile devices, and access to networks.

4.2 Internet and Email Usage: Company networks and communication systems are to be used for professional purposes. Limited, incidental personal use may be permissible during non-work hours, provided it does not interfere with job duties or violate other company policies. Excessive personal use, or any use for illegal, inappropriate, or offensive content, is strictly forbidden.

4.3 Professional Conduct: Sterling Corp expects all employees to maintain a professional and respectful demeanor at all times. Harassment, discrimination, or any form of disrespectful behavior will not be tolerated. We strive to foster a collaborative and inclusive work environment. Employees are also expected to adhere to all applicable laws and regulations, including those pertaining to non-disclosure agreements and the ethical use of proprietary information.

4.4 External Agreements: Employees must not enter into any external agreements or commitments on behalf of Sterling Corp without explicit written authorization from their direct supervisor and the Legal Department. This includes, but is not limited to, vendor contracts, service agreements, and any commitments that could create a financial or legal obligation for the company. For instance, while the company offers resources to help employees secure suitable housing, any individual apartment lease agreement entered into by an employee is a personal contract, and company authorization is not required unless the lease involves company property or assets in some capacity.

問題

Which activity is strictly forbidden according to the policy on Internet and Email Usage?

選択肢

  1. A. Sending a brief personal email during a lunch break.
  2. B. Accessing company news portals for work-related research.
  3. C. Engaging in extensive personal browsing during work hours. ✓
  4. D. Communicating with colleagues about project details.

正解

C. Engaging in extensive personal browsing during work hours.

解説

📖 本文の和訳 — これはSterling Corp.の従業員ハンドブックからの抜粋です。セクション4「会社のリソースの使用と行動」では、提供されたすべての機器、ソフトウェア、資料は会社の所有物であり、ビジネス目的のみに使用されるべきであると述べています。許可されていない個人的な使用、変更、または持ち出しは固く禁じられています。
📝 正解理由 — 本文には「Unauthorized personal use... is strictly prohibited.」(許可されていない個人的な使用…は固く禁じられています。)と明記されています。選択肢3の「Engaging in extensive personal browsing during work hours.」(勤務時間中に広範な個人的なブラウジングに従事すること。)は、職務時間中に個人的なウェブ閲覧を多量に行うことを意味し、これは明らかに許可されていない個人的な使用に該当するため禁止されています。
💡 試験対策 — Part 7 では、「prohibited」、「forbidden」、「not allowed」といった禁止を示す言葉に注意を払ってください。これらの言葉は、質問で「forbidden」のような否定的な表現で提示された場合に、重要な手がかりとなります。
📊 不正解選択肢の分析 —
X) Sending a brief personal email during a lunch break — 短い個人的なメールは、通常、昼休み中に許可される可能性があり、「extensive」という言葉がないため、本文で明示的に禁止されている範囲には該当しません。
X) Accessing company news portals for work-related research — 業務関連の研究のために会社のニュースポータルにアクセスすることは、ビジネス目的に該当するため許可されます。
X) Communicating with colleagues about project details — 同僚とプロジェクトの詳細についてコミュニケーションをとることは、業務上不可欠な活動であるため許可されます。
